Yamakyu Chain Co of Tokyo, has selected Victrex Peek polymer as the material of choice for its slat band chains for conveyor systems.

The chains withstand exposure to temperatures as high as 250C, run at a rate of 200m/min without lubrication and provide inherent chemical resistance and antistatic properties.

The chains have an ideal fit on high-speed beverage and food processing lines, where high heat resistance and superior chemical resistance are especially required.

Traditionally the food processing industry has used intermesh, low friction transfer plates made from acetal.

However, acetal plastic's low heat resistance of 80C prohibits its use in high-temperature environments.

Furthermore, Victrex Peek polymer offers superior long-term resistance against detergent (including chlorine and hydrogen peroxide), and can also withstand UV sterilisation.

Stainless steel has been used typically for chains requiring high heat resistance.

However, to ensure smooth operation, stainless steel chains need lubrication, which creates adhesion problems and product contamination.

Conveyor belt chains made from Victrex Peek polymer, on the other hand, require no lubrication and are a third of the weight of stainless steel chains.

This allows motor downsizing, which saves power and reduces operating noise.

A leading manufacturer of slat band chains for conveyers, Yamakyu is focused on offering customers a total solution, from chain selection to the design and manufacture of a complete conveyor system to meet individual requirements.

Building on the success of Peek polymer chains in the food processing industry, Yamakyu is actively promoting their use in a wide variety of industrial applications.
